Beersheba Old Students Association (BOSA) is happy  to announce that its relentless assiduous representation to Jamaica Library Service since September 2014 to have Broadband Internet WiFi Service provided at Lewisville Branch Library, New Market, Saint Elizabeth, Jamaica West Indies has borne fruit.

Provision of State of the Art Broadband Internet WiFi Service and Desk Top Computers at Lewisville Branch Library will greatly assist and benefit students and adults from the impoverished peasant farming Beersheba Primary School, Lewisville High School, Nightingale Grove Primary School, and other educational institutions in these communities.

Non Boarding High School Students who attend Munro College, Saint Elizabeth Technical High School, Lacovia High School, Maggotty High School, and Maud McLeod High School and commute to and from school daily, are elated to know that instead of having to travel 14 or more miles from their homes to Saint Elizabeth Parish Library, Black River to do their school work assignments and research in Information Technology (IT) they can now visit Lewisville Branch Library to accomplish this task.

Lewisville Branch Library operates as a full time library with business hours Monday – Friday 9:00AM-5:00PM and Saturday 9:00-1:00PM

Beersheba Old Students Association (BOSA) is delighted to work in partnership with Jamaica Library Service to bring State of the Art Broadband Internet WiFi Service to Lewisville Branch Library.
